Зміст
Викладачі курсів QA – практикуючі інженери та розробники програмних продуктів. Це означає, що їхні знання є актуальними, і слухачі зможуть застосовувати їх у роботі відразу після закінчення навчання. Особливо, якщо йдеться про ручне проведення тест-кейсів та написання документації. Ця робота підходить для людей з відповідним мисленням. Словом, QA фахівець – це людина, яка перевіряє програмний продукт вздовж та впоперек. Тестувальник з’ясовує, як ПО поведеться при очікуваному або відмінному від очікуваного поведінки користувача.
Робота системного архітектора полягає в тому, щоби вибудувати схему розробки того чи іншого продукту з нуля. Це ІТ-спеціаліст, який приймає рішення щодо функціоналу та інтерфейсу цілих програмних комплексів майбутніх продуктів. Можна сказати, що це той, хто трансформує слова та бажання клієнта в модель продукту, яку можна реалізувати, враховуючи можливості та ресурси компанії. Має бути висококласним спеціалістом, який знається на багатьох технологіях, щоб вміти обрати найоптимальнішу. У середньому такому спеціалісту в Україні платять 5000 доларів на місяць. Manual testing— це процес ручної перевірки програмного забезпечення на помилки.
Чи довго вчитися на QA інженера?
Напівтехнічні навички сфокусовані на оптимізації роботи. Знання процесів розробки продукту допомагає зрозуміти, як та з ким QA-інженеру потрібно співпрацювати для досягнення мети. Навички критики передбачають розуміння принципів middle qa engineer об’єктивності, вміння давати оцінку та ставити правильні питання. Також іноді треба запропонувати інші варіанти вирішення поточних проблем. Вміння вести документацію допоможе інформативно та доступно описувати певну інформацію.
А тестування є однією з найбільш важливих складових ІТ-сфери. Системний адміністратор — це фахівець, який підтримує правильну роботу комп’ютерної техніки і програмного забезпечення, а також відповідає за інформаційну безпеку організації. Професія Technical Artist перебуває на межі програмування та створення контенту. Розповідаємо про обов’язки цих спеціалістів, плюси та мінуси професії, а також що потрібно знати й вміти, аби стати технічним художником в геймдеві.
- Все, що тобі потрібно – це внести оплату за перші два місяця навчання, решта платежів буде вноситись кожні 8 занять.
- Щодо самого продукту, то виділяють тестування прототипів, альфа-тестування, бета-тестування і пострелізне тестування.
- Він контролює якість функціональності продукту, займається пошуком та регресією багів, виконанням щоденних smoke-тестів.
- Тестувальники, які працюють у невеликих компаніях, — це, частіше за все, майстри на всі руки, так звані універсали.
- Поділіться своїм досвідом – що Вам сподобалось, а що ні!
- Після кожного заняття від викладача ви отримуватимете всі методичні матеріали, презентації, які використовувалися на занятті, а також додаткову літературу для самостійного вивчення.
Зарплата фахівця-початківця, як уже було сказано, стартує від 500 доларів. Якщо ви досягнете такого рівня для тестувальників як senior у Києві, то ваша зарплата може досягти понад 2000 доларів. Тестувальник ПЗ, або Quality Assurance tester – людина, яка шукає (і знаходить!) баги у програмному продукті після його впровадження.
Що входить в обов’язки QA Engineer?
З плюсів – було достатньо практики та тестів з ISTQB. Працюю в компанії GlobalLogic на позиції QA automation Team Lead та викладаю в IT-школі A-Level на курсі тестування. За роки практики накопичилося багато досвіду та корисних висновків, якими я хочу з вами поділитися. З його допомогою очікувані сценарії порівнюються з тим, що отримує користувач, вказуються розбіжності. Автоматизоване тестування краще використовувати, коли йдеться про роботу над великим проектом, і у тестовій системі буде багато користувачів.
Найближчим часом з тобою зв’яжеться наш менеджер, щоб відповісти на запитання. Ця професія вимагає наявності і постійного застосування аналітичних здібностей. Вона не дає розслабитися і розумово деградувати, а змушує постійно вивчати нові технології і галузі знань. Привертає QA-інженерів можливість покращувати якість продукту і при цьому освоювати різні технології і вникати в деталі продукту. Якби ми говорили про медицину, то QA займалися б профілактикою, а тестувальники – діагностикою. Але так склалося, що ці дві різні професії стали синонімами.
А що можете порадити із літератури на тему автоматизованого тестування? По Selenium WebDriver вже почитую, але хотілося б щось загальне на тему автоматизації. Також тестувальник іноді виконує специфічні запити з боку розробників. Наприклад, проводить поглиблене тестування конкретної фічі, компонента або бере участь у масових ігрових сесіях. Окрім цього, QA може тестувати супутні сервіси, необхідні для створення гри.
Фахівцям подобається гнучкість цієї спеціалізації, можливість долучитися до цікавих і важливих проєктів та робота з однодумцями. Технічний спеціаліст, який налаштовує інфраструктуру, необхідну для проєкту. Аналітик, який вивчає вимоги та перетворює ідеї у функціональність, яку можна перевірити.
Особливості тестування мобільних додатків
Ми команда постійно практикуючих спеціалістів в галузі інтернет-маркетингу, зокрема маркетингу в соціальних мережах. Також необхідне вміння дивитися на продукт з точки зору кінцевого користувача. Це була одна з технічних професій в IT, пиши коментарі, про яку професію хочеш дізнатися більше в наступному пості. Ні, оплата проводиться тільки на розрахунковий рахунок. Оплата провадиться через виставлення інвойсу на E-mail через сервіси LiqPay та Fondy. Оплата здійснюється через виставлення інвойсу на e-mail через сервіси LiqPay, Fondy та Mono Pay.
Зазвичай функції даної спеціальності виконує кілька людей. Залежно від обов’язків, їх посади поділяються на кілька видів. Містять інтерактивні лекції, практичні завдання, чати для постійного спілкування та підтримки з боку викладачів, величезну базу навчальних матеріалів.
Які навички потрібні, щоб стати QA в геймдеві
Ближче до фіналу навчання рекрутер школи збирає резюме та подає на співбесіди до компаній-партнерів, які вже мають відкриті позиції та знають рівень наших студентів. Вони лояльно ставляться до студентів школи, оскільки багато випускників A-Level вже потрапили до наших партнерів. API — це тип тестування програмного забезпечення, який визначає, чи відповідає нещодавно розроблений додаток очікуванням з точки зору надійності, продуктивності, операцій та безпеки.
7. Senior QA та QA Tech Lead
Середня заробітна плата в Україні — 4000 доларів на місяць. На курсі QA Automation ви дізнаєтеся основи ООП, навчитеся користуватися основною бібліотекою мови https://wizardsdev.com/ Java і отримаєте навички автоматизації тестування Selenium. Ми підготували матеріали та тести, які допоможуть вам у виборі вашої майбутньої професії.
Переваги й недоліки роботи QA в геймдеві
Також з тобою працюватимуть наші координатори, які допоможуть знайти роботу та компанію мрії. На цьому уроці ви ближче познайомитись з командою та спікерами, що будуть проводити ваше навчання, також дізнаєтесь історію виникнення тестування, її цілі, завдання та принципи. Складемо портрет тестувальника та поговоримо про варіанти кар’єрного розвитку. Найвищі зарплати пропонують роботодавці з великих міст — у Києві та Харкові тестувальник може заробляти грн на місяць. На оплату праці впливає також досвід фахівця і рівень його професіоналізму, бажання навчатися, а ще форма співпраці (постійне працевлаштування або фріланс).
Ми почнемо з самих азів — вивчимо базові технічні поняття, а потім перейдемо до самих способів та особливостей тестування. Навіть якщо ти нічого не знаєш про цю професію – процес навчання пройде максимально зрозуміло та зручно. Ви перейматимете досвід людей, які працюють у великих IT-компаніях і розуміють як подати матеріал у зрозумілому для тебе алгоритмі. За групою буде закріплена людина, яка супроводжуватиме у процесі навчання та допомагатиме у всіх незрозумілих питаннях — від технічних та до експертних за матеріалами курсу. Успішні тестувальники мають володіти не тільки технічними навичками, а й певними особистісними рисами.
Також обов’язковою умовою є відвідування занять з англійської мови. Слухач отримає відгук і досвід від фахівця із перших вуст. Ви опрацьовує помилки і закріплюєте пройдений матеріал.
Найбільш поширений недолік полягає в тому, що на деяких проектах робота зводиться до одноманітного запуску тестів без розробки нових. Насамперед, будьте готові, що у вас запитають про все, що ви вказали у резюме. Тому варто вказувати ті скіли та технології, якими ви дійсно володієте.
Щоб засвоїти матеріал і успішно завершити курси напрямку тобі обов’язково потрібно виконувати всі домашні завдання. Так ти будеш повноцінно готуватися до майбутньої роботи розробника-тестувальника й обдумувати запитання, які не спали на думку під час трансляції. Усі ІТ-компаній прагнуть відмінної роботи програмного забезпечення.
Це не страшно, ми здійснюємо відеозапис усіх лекцій, вони доступні після заняття у твоєму особистому кабінеті. Матеріали на сайті підготовлено за підтримки Європейського Союзу та Міжнародного Фонду «Відродження» в межах грантового компоненту проєкту EU4USociety . Матеріали відображають позицію авторів і не обов’язково відображають позицію Міжнародного фонду «Відродження» та Європейського Союзу». Основний акцент в процесі навчання ми робимо на практику. За підсумками кожного уроку вам треба буде виконати кілька практичних завдань для відпрацювання отриманих навичок.
Наразі розвиваюсь в напрямку управляння командами, налагодження процесів QA, аудиту проектів та ресурсного менеджменту. В школі A-level викладаю уже другий рік, викладацька діяльність – це моя дитяча мрія та хобі, що надихає і мотивує розвиватися далі. Якщо ви стали випускником A-Level та отримали сертифікат про успішне закінчення курсу, школа допомагає вам знайти вакансії в IT-компаніях за новим фахом на позицію trainee або junior спеціаліста. Рекрутинговий відділ консультує вас з питань складання резюме та проходження співбесід, за можливістю пропонує актуальні вакансії.
Працює з базами даних, наприклад, з Oracle або MSSQL. Доведеться багато сидіти за комп’ютером і окремо займатися підтримкою фізичної форми. Окрема перевірка модулів для знаходження тих, які викликають проблему. Майбутні QA набувають знання на курсах або ж самостійно.